As the title says, would it be possible for eslint to show warnings instead of errors on ALL of the rules? I'm using Standard JS, if that information is relevant.

I think there's no out-of-the-box option right now, but maybe you could use a plugin to achieve that: Eslint plugin only warn
Or set all the rules as warning instead of errors.
Following es-lint-plugin-prettier readme, edit your .eslintrc.json and put a specific rule for prettier:
"rules": {
// maybe your other rules...
"prettier/prettier": "warn"
}
Then, prettier rules will be issued as warnings instead of errors.
Not sure of all the side effects, but it seems to work ok for my project, where I also use @typescript-eslint/eslint-plugin, @typescript-eslint/parser, eslint-config-prettier and eslint-plugin-prettier.
If it helps, my extends config in .eslintrc.json:
"extends": [
"eslint:recommended",
"plugin:@typescript-eslint/eslint-recommended",
"plugin:@typescript-eslint/recommended",
"prettier/@typescript-eslint",
"plugin:prettier/recommended"
],
You can create an .eslintrc file with all the rules set to "warn"
If you already have an eslintrc file you can use that, or extend from a rules file such as the one here. In this one, all the rules are set to 0 (disabled). You can modify specific ones or all of them and set them to 1 (or "warn")
